Penrith’s shock loss to South Sydney in week one of the NRL Finals has seen them drift in the TAB Premiership market from $2.75 out to $3.75.
The Panthers have been the best backed team to win the title with 31 percent of the market but will now face either Parramatta or Newcastle in sudden-death football next weekend, before a potential Preliminary Final against Premiership favourites Melbourne.
TAB has cut South Sydney’s Premiership odds from $11 into $5.50 after the 16-10 victory. They’ve been reinstalled as third favourite for the title above Manly who have drifted from $6.50 out to $8 following Friday night’s loss to the Storm.
However, the Sea Eagles have opened as $1.32 favourites against the Roosters ($3.40) for next week’s knockout semi, after the Roosters survived a major scare from the Titans.
The Eels are $1.40 favourites against the Knights at $3, in the remaining week one elimination final.
